I bought two MH pendants. I am told they are Hamilton's that were purchased at Aqua Mart a few years ago.


My question is how high off the water is optimum for these lights. They will cover 48" x 24" and 12" deep. I'm having problems finding information about these light because there are no markings on the pendants and the drivers only say electronic ballasts.



Does anyone have any suggestions or information about these lights?

you will probably want them 18-24 inches off the water. Also, they need new bulbs. Order some 14k phoenix bulbs or 20k hamilton's. I strongly recommend the 14k phoenixs.

Lookup the markings on google images and it'll pull up phoenix 14k bulbs. I mark my bulbs in permanent marker on the non-glass part with the date so I know when I installed them, I ran for a year at 4 hours per day and then replaced them - kept them in the old box (labeled again with the end date) - this way you'll always have backups in a pinch or can't afford to buy bulbs when they go out.
